An insider’s guide to the pleasures
of exploring 20 little-known places
within an hour or less of Paris by train:

  • discovering half-hidden châteaux, museums and writers’ country houses
  • walking, boating and dancing by the river
  • exploring old towns and country footpaths
  • eating in family-run restaurants with 1950s decor and prices to match
